Output 80592491ff33bc1e74f81b1e9fd090102e071903368be6d562ffce9402b6ab28:15

value
76649
script pubkey
OP_0 OP_PUSHBYTES_32 ecece5cd49784f653a8af458ba2ad8b90af7f5786628c102af3758099cdfca28
address
bc1qankwtn2f0p8k2w5273vt52kchy900atcvc5vzq40xavqn8xleg5ql7tq04
transaction
80592491ff33bc1e74f81b1e9fd090102e071903368be6d562ffce9402b6ab28
confirmations
169024
spent
true